Plan accordingly
When preparing for a road trip, regardless of your route, it’s essential to factor in the time it takes to travel during peak traffic periods. According to a study by INRIX, a transportation data company, Chicago ranks fifth among cities with the worst traffic in the United States. The study showed that drivers in the Chicago metropolitan area spent an average of 138 hours a year stuck in traffic. That is a lot of time spent sitting in your car!
